Vincent John 'Jack' Nolan Jr., 88, Of Wilton

WILTON, Conn. – Vincent John 'Jack' Nolan Jr., of Wilton, died Oct. 18 at St. Vincent’s Medical Center. He was 88.

Nolan was born July 29, 1927, in Cleveland, Ohio, to Vincent John Nolan Sr. and Agnes Sharples.

He joined the U.S. Navy in 1944 and served in Japan during the end of World War II.

After his service, Nolan founded Nolan Associates of Wilton, serving as the company's president.

He was predeceased by his parents, brother Richard 'Dick' Nolan, two sisters, Phyllis Southard and Marijane Barry.

Nolan is survived by his wife Ellen of Wilton; four children Vincent J. Nolan III and his wife Guilana of Avon, Barbara Nolan Rossi of Wilton, Michelle Bartlett and her husband Hugh Bartlett of Fairfield and Kevin J. Nolan and his wife Fran of Fairfield, 14 grandchildren, and two sisters, Nancy Hughes of Illinois and Judy Garvin of Minnesota.

Visiting hours will be Thursday at the Bouton Funeral Home, 31 W. Church St., Georgetown.

Services will be at 10 a.m. Friday at Our Lady of Fatima Catholic Church, 229 Danbury Road, Wilton.
